Start each day with gratitude. This daily meditation will provide self-love by sending love to yourself and others. Release tension with a body scan, promote relaxation while following your breath, and find gratitude.

Transcript

When you're ready,

Make yourself comfortable,

Whether it's sitting in a position,

In a chair,

Or laying down.

Close your eyes.

Take a few deep breaths and settle your mind.

Follow your breath.

Inhale,

One,

Two.

Exhale,

One,

Two,

Three,

Four.

Inhale,

One,

Two.

Exhale,

One,

Two,

Three,

Four.

Let your body relax.

Bring awareness to your head,

Forehead.

Relax your eyes,

Nose,

Lips,

Jaw.

Release tension in your neck,

Shoulders,

Down your arms,

Into the hands and fingers.

Let your back become more relaxed.

Bring awareness to your upper back.

How does it feel?

Your mid-back,

Lower back.

Relax your hips,

Down your legs,

Into the feet and toes.

Bring awareness into your body.

Is there anywhere that tension is still lingering?

Let your body feel heavy and relaxed.

Have your mind follow the inhale.

And any thoughts that come and go with your exhale,

Bring gratitude to your breath.

As I breathe in,

I am thankful for this day.

As I woke up today and was able to live,

I see this moment as it is,

Peaceful and calm.

I give gratitude to my body and what it does for me.

My organs that work without me consciously having to tell them what to do.

My hands for everything that they let me do in the day.

My feet for taking me places.

With gratitude,

I send love to my family.

I send love to my friends.

I send love to acquaintances.

I send love to strangers.

I send love to the unloving.

I send love to all beings.

May I find love and gratitude in my toughest times.

Forgive others in their hardships.

May I give others strength and receive strength from others when I struggle.

In this moment,

I find many things in my life to be thankful for.

I am blessed,

And may I be a blessing to others.

Take a moment to reflect.

Send love to yourself.

Know you are enough,

And you are loved.

When you're ready,

Slowly open your eyes.

Namaste.
